Texas 2021 - 87th Regular

Texas House Bill HR926

Caption

In memory of Captain Reginald Dewayne Williams of Dallas Fire-Rescue.

Summary

H.R. No. 926 is a resolution honoring the life and service of Captain Reginald Dewayne Williams of the Dallas Fire-Rescue, who passed away on April 5, 2021. The resolution acknowledges his significant contributions to the fire department, his community, and his family. Williams had a commendable 29-year career in the Dallas Fire-Rescue, during which he rose to the rank of captain and received a Medal of Valor for his bravery. The resolution serves as a tribute to his legacy and impact on those around him.
